Ex-Yukos Investors Can't Mail Subpoenas In Russia Tax Row
Former Yukos Energy Co. shareholders trying to revive $50 billion in arbitral awards must serve in person a lawyer who is believed to have helped Russia manipulate Armenian courts into issuing certain rulings that influenced related Dutch proceedings, a California federal judge said on Monday, finding a magistrate made no mistake in denying the shareholders' request to do so by other means.

Russia Told Of Subpoena Efforts, Ex-Yukos Shareholders Say
Former Yukos shareholders seeking court permission to subpoena a lawyer believed to know of Russian meddling in Armenian rulings that allegedly affected their bankruptcy in the Netherlands told a California federal court Tuesday they notified Russia when they attempted to serve the lawyer by alternative means but believed it was unnecessary to tell the court.

Yukos Shareholders Face More Roadblocks In Russia Tax Row
Former Yukos shareholders, who are attempting to subpoena a lawyer for evidence that could be used to revive $50 billion in arbitral awards over allegedly fabricated tax debts from Russia, have been ordered by a California federal judge to explain why they have failed to notify opposing counsel of their latest motion.

Yukos Investors Want Magistrate Judge Order Reviewed
Former Yukos Oil Co. shareholders trying to subpoena a lawyer for evidence that could be used to revive $50 billion in arbitral awards reiterated their bid to serve him by alternate means, telling a California federal judge on Tuesday that a magistrate judge erred in denying their request.
